The inside story
The Grand Bazaar is one of the largest and oldest covered markets in the world, with 61 covered streets and over 4,000 shops in a total area of over 33,000 ft², attracting between 250,000 and 400,000 visitors daily.
Located inside the walled city of Istanbul, the Grand Bazaar is within walking distance to many of Istanbul’s other tourist attractions such as the Hagia Sophia and the Blue Mosque. With over 20 different entrances to the bazaar it can be easy to lose your bearings so it’s a good idea to have a map handy or book a guided tour. The market is separated by type of goods, so if you are only looking for one specific thing then it can be helpful to know which street its on and the best gate to enter to get there. But don’t forget to take your time strolling through the market as you admire the bright lights, countless colors and take in the smells of spices, sweets and perfumes. Getting lost in the Bazaar is all part of the experience and there is always plenty of signage around to get you back on your way!
